When it comes to event planning, costs can vary widely depending on the scale, complexity, and location of the event. Event planners typically offer a range of services, from full-service event management to day-of coordination, with corresponding price tags. On average, event planners in the United States charge anywhere from $1,500 to $15,000 or more per event, depending on the level of service required.

The cost of hiring an event planner is often determined by factors such as the size of the event, the complexity of the logistics involved, and the level of customization desired. For large-scale events such as weddings, corporate galas, or fundraising dinners, event planners may charge a percentage of the overall budget, typically ranging from 10% to 20%. This percentage-based fee structure allows event planners to tailor their services to meet the specific needs and budget constraints of their clients.

In addition to the base fee, event planners may also charge for additional services such as venue selection, vendor management, design and décor, catering, entertainment, and transportation. These à la carte services can add to the overall cost of hiring an event planner, but they offer a convenient one-stop solution for busy clients who want to streamline the planning process.

For clients seeking a more hands-on approach, some event planners offer hourly consulting services at rates ranging from $75 to $200 per hour. This option allows clients to benefit from the expertise of an event planner on an as-needed basis, without committing to a full-service package.
